Bruce & Anne Bundy Foundation Trust 113093 22114739 is a private trust based in MILWAUKEE, WI. The foundation received its IRS ruling in 1994. The principal officer is Bank Of California Ttee. It holds total assets of $7.4M. Annual income is reported at $971K. The foundation is governed by 2 officers and trustees. According to its most recent filing, the foundation only makes contributions to preselected charitable organizations. Tax records are available from 2021 to 2023. Grantmaking is concentrated in California. According to available records, Bruce & Anne Bundy Foundation Trust 113093 22114739 has made 32 grants totaling $1.4M, with a median grant of $23K. Annual giving has decreased from $903K in 2022 to $450K in 2023. Individual grants have ranged from $7K to $100K, with an average award of $42K. The foundation has supported 14 unique organizations. Grant recipients are concentrated in California. Contributions to this foundation are tax-deductible.
